5 Proven Strategies for Organizing Indie Game Devlogs
5 Proven Strategies for Organizing Indie Game Devlogs
Are you an indie game developer feeling overwhelmed by scattered notes and lost ideas? You’re not alone. Keeping a clear game dev journal is crucial for tracking progress, but many struggle to maintain organized game development logs. Let’s explore five proven strategies to structure your devlogs for long-term usefulness. This is about maximizing your future self’s ability to understand your past decisions.
Why Bother with Organized Devlogs?
Think of your devlog as a time machine. Six months from now, will you remember why you chose that specific shade of green for your UI? Will you recall the exact problem you were trying to solve with that complex enemy AI behavior? A well-organized game dev journal allows you to quickly revisit past decisions, understand your reasoning, and avoid repeating mistakes. Consistent journaling is an investment in your project’s longevity and your own sanity. It’s also a great way to track game development progress and see how far you’ve come.
1. Embrace Iterative Structure
Don’t aim for perfection from the start. Start simple and refine your devlog structure over time. This is about clarity emerging through iteration. Initially, you might use broad categories like “Art,” “Programming,” and “Design.” As your project evolves, you’ll identify more specific categories that better reflect your workflow. For example, “Programming” might split into “AI,” “Physics,” and “UI.”
Common Pitfall: Trying to create the perfect structure upfront. This leads to analysis paralysis and discourages you from even starting. Solution: Start with a basic structure and adjust it as needed. Think of it as agile development, but for documentation.
2. Tagging is Your Friend
Tags are keywords that help you quickly find specific information within your devlog. Use them liberally. If you’re working on a combat system, tag entries with “Combat,” “AI,” “Animation,” and any other relevant keywords. This makes searching for related information much easier than relying solely on category-based organization. Think of tags as metadata that unlocks the full potential of your game dev journal.
Common Pitfall: Using too few tags or being inconsistent with your tagging. Solution: Develop a consistent tagging system and stick to it. Consider using a controlled vocabulary to ensure consistency.
3. The Power of Consistent Formatting
Consistent formatting makes your devlog easier to read and scan. Use headings, subheadings, bullet points, and numbered lists to break up text and highlight key information. Standardize your format for each entry. For example, you might always include sections for “Goals,” “Progress,” “Challenges,” and “Next Steps.” This predictability allows you to quickly find the information you need, even months later.
Common Pitfall: Using inconsistent formatting, making it difficult to quickly find specific information. Solution: Create a template for your devlog entries and stick to it.
4. Implement a Searchable System
A searchable system is essential for quickly finding specific information within your devlog. Choose a tool that supports robust search functionality. This could be a dedicated journaling app, a note-taking app like Obsidian or Notion, or even a simple text editor with search capabilities. The key is to be able to quickly locate specific entries or tags. This is where the real power of a well-organized game development log shines.
Common Pitfall: Relying on a system without search capabilities, making it difficult to find specific information. Solution: Prioritize search functionality when choosing a tool for your devlog.
5. Link Back to Previous Entries
When you make changes to a system or feature, link back to the original devlog entries where you first discussed it. This creates a web of interconnected information, allowing you to easily trace the evolution of your game. This is especially useful for understanding why certain decisions were made and avoiding unintended consequences when making changes. Imagine being able to instantly see the entire history of your game’s movement system, from initial concept to final implementation.
Common Pitfall: Not linking related entries, making it difficult to understand the context of past decisions. Solution: Get into the habit of linking related entries whenever you make changes or revisit a topic.
Step-by-Step Guide: Building a Searchable Devlog System
Let’s build a simple, searchable devlog system using a note-taking app.
- Choose your tool: Select a note-taking app that supports tagging and searching.
- Create your categories: Start with broad categories like “Art,” “Programming,” and “Design.”
- Develop a tagging system: Create a list of common tags that you’ll use consistently.
- Create a template: Design a template for your devlog entries with sections for “Goals,” “Progress,” “Challenges,” and “Next Steps.”
- Start documenting: Begin writing devlog entries using your template and tagging relevant information.
- Link related entries: Whenever you make changes or revisit a topic, link back to the original entries.
- Refine your structure: As your project evolves, adjust your categories and tagging system as needed.
By following these steps, you’ll create a searchable devlog system that helps you track game development progress and make informed decisions.
Ready to Streamline Your Devlog Process?
Maintaining a consistent and organized game dev journal is essential for indie game developers. It helps you track your progress, avoid repeating mistakes, and make informed decisions. But setting up and maintaining such a system can be time-consuming. That’s where our journaling tool comes in. Effective Game Dev Journaling is designed to streamline your documentation process, making it easier than ever to track your game development journey. Try it today and experience the benefits of a well-organized devlog!